How This Underwater Crash Game Works

Under Pressure takes a completely different approach from traditional slot games. Instead of spinning reels and matching symbols, this game revolves around a submarine diving deeper into the ocean. As your submarine descends in Under Pressure, a multiplier increases continuously until the pressure becomes too much and the submarine "crashes." The key to success is cashing out before this happens. There are no paylines in the conventional sense – your wins are determined by your betting amount multiplied by whatever multiplier you cash out at.

Betting Options and Return Potential

With Under Pressure, Real Time Gaming has created a game accessible to all types of players. Bets start as low as $0.01 for cautious players, while high-rollers can wager up to $25 per dive. The RTP (Return to Player) of Under Pressure sits at a competitive 96%, which is higher than many traditional slot games. The volatility in this title is entirely dependent on your playing style – conservative players who cash out at lower multipliers will experience lower volatility, while risk-takers aiming for massive multipliers will face higher variance in their gameplay experience.
